Mercury(II) sulfate react with water
4HgSO
4
+ 2H
2
O → 2H
2
SO
4
+ HgSO
4
•2HgO
[ Check the balance ]
Mercury(II) sulfate react with water to produce sulfuric acid and adduct mercury(II) sulfate and mercury(II) oxide.
